Andy and Jessica welcome you to another episode of The Deal Board Podcast. This week they are talking about the economy and economics, a certainly prevalent topic in 2023. Howard Yaruss and Barry Sloane accompany Andy and Jessica in today’s episode. Howard is a professor at NYU, author of Understandable Economics: Because Understanding Our Economy Is Easier Than You Think and More Important Than You Know (among others), and is addressing the economy while sharing his expertise in business brokerage and M&A business as well. Barry Sloane, President and CEO of Newtek Business Services Corp., talks about the economy and the newest expansion of Newtek.
